How does the purity of kaolin clay china affect ceramic whiteness in Hungarian production?

The purity of kaolin directly determines the iron oxide content; lower iron levels result in a brighter, more consistent white finish, which is critical for the luxury porcelain market in Hungary.

What are the primary advantages of using bagged bentonite for waterproofing in Budapest?

Bagged bentonite offers ease of installation and immediate swelling upon contact with water, creating a self-sealing hydraulic barrier ideal for the variable soil conditions found in the Budapest region.

What is the typical process for bentonite treatment to improve adsorption?

Our treatment involves chemical activation using specific salts or acids to increase the cation exchange capacity (CEC), enhancing the mineral's ability to bind pollutants in wastewater.

Is white vermiculite suitable for high-temperature industrial furnaces in Hungary?

Absolutely. White vermiculite is prized for its exceptional fire resistance and low thermal conductivity, making it an ideal lining material for industrial kilns and furnaces.
